It was never a great hotel but our last visit the other week was just the worst.
Staying in Brunei, Miri is always an attractive option for a few days. The Miri Marriott is about as good as it gets in terms of choice but they really need to improve.
it starts at Reception. I have travelled extensively but rarely come across more surly people behind the desk. As unwelcoming and as unhelpful as you can find.
At least many of the rooms have been upgraded now so that is a great improvement from before but counterweigh that with a breakfast buffet which has just gone from bad to worse. The quality of the food on the counters is at the very cheap end of the spectrum cheap ham, cheap cheese, cheap jam etc etc. Once upon a time they used to have great breakfast with lovely fresh home made jams. To make matters worse much of the food is uncovered allowing young children to handle the food. I would question how hygenic their breakfast counter really is
We go to this hotel because of their great pool for the kids. They have for years had a sand fly problem which seems to be getting worse. I was bitten badly this time as were 4 others in our group. The hotel seems to be doing nothing to resolve this problem.
i would strongly suggest that people think hard before going there.

We came here just for a weekend getaway. As a elite member we were given a suite room for the stay. The standard of Miri Marriott is far from other Marriott chain hotel. But price wise almost the same. The room given is old and required an immediate refurbished.

Housekeeping service is very poor. Amenities were not refilled. We were given a set of very small shampoo for our 2 nights stay. No face towels and spare toilet paper!!

Food is ok. But some dishes would be good if serve hot such as the porridge.

The only good things is the big pool with slides and outdoor facilities.

Overall this is like a 4 stars hotel but 5 stars pricing.

The Hotel has comfortable clean rooms, big swimmingpool and above all very very nice staff. You need a taxi to visit the town Centre but of course there is a shuttle service. In the neighbourhood of the hotel there are very good local restaurants. We made trips to Lambir Hills and Niah caves.
